} kn KLEINFELDER <br /> CLIENT RESPONSIBILITIES AND ASSUMPTIONS <br /> This proposal and the attached cost estimate are based on the following assumptions: { <br /> • Adequate work space and access will be provided. Kleinfelder will attempt to advance <br /> soil borings and collect samples at the proposed locations. If the drilling equipment <br /> cannot be positioned, alternative drilling locations or sampling methods should be <br /> investigated. <br /> Traffic control and its associated costs are not included in this proposal. <br /> • The borings are to be drilled with a truck mounted drill rig equipped with hollow stem <br /> augers. If difficult drilling conditions are encountered, alternative sampling methods <br /> may be necessary. <br /> • Soil and water generated during the drilling and sampling will be the responsibility of <br /> the client. Soil generated from the drilling operation will be placed on and covered by <br /> i <br /> visqueen. Equipment rinseate will be generated from the steam-cleaning and <br /> decontamination of drilling and sampling equipment. The rinseate will be contained in <br /> 55-gallon drums. Wastes will be left on site for disposal/reuse/mitigation by the client. <br /> Sampling and analysis of the soil and/or water maj be necessary prior to disposal/reuse <br /> or mitigation. Disposal or remediation options for the soil and water can be assessed <br /> once analytical results have been received. Kleinfelder is prepared to assist the client, j <br /> if requested, at an additional cost. <br /> • This proposal is based on the presumption that the client will clearly mark utilities and <br /> will provide any and all available survey maps or other data to determine the location of <br /> tanks, existing structures, underground utilities and services. <br /> I <br /> • The client should be aware that penetrating the site's surface is inherently risky. It is <br /> impossible to determine with certainty the precise location of all structures (such as <br /> septic system tanks or leach fields) which may be buried in the ground. Kleinfelder's <br /> fee is not adequate to compensate for both the performance of the services and the <br /> assumption of risk of damage to such structures. <br /> i <br /> • Underground Services Alert (USA) at 1-800-642-2444 provides a partial location <br /> service free of charge for major utility, lines. It is important to understand that <br /> subsurface structures (such as the septic systems and leach fields) buried under private <br /> property will not be marked by the public utility companies contacted by USA. <br /> Kleinfelder can make contact with USA for a site visit, if requested. <br /> 20-YP8-262/2018P285r/2018C595 Page A-4 <br /> Copyright 1998,Kleinfelder, Inc.
